Oh, Osiris Eldridge of Illinois State. You may have lost to Drake in the MVC championship this past weekend, but you won the most important battle of all: The fight for the crown of most freakishly stylish hairdo of the ‘07-‘08 hoops season.
There’s so much here: The rare black dude mohawk, the perfectly sculpted zero in the side of the head, the intricately trimmed basketball backdrop. I’m left simply speechless in its presence. This is truly a work for the archives, a bold arrow pointing the way to bigger, better frontiers in NCAA hoops coiffure, a pioneer in the field matched only by Russell Westbrook for daring and design.
All bow to Mighty Osiris! With hair like that, you are powerless not to, peasant.↵
